1. The Average Lifespan: A Spot on the Timeline 🕒
So, how long do these spotted cuties stick around? On average, a well-cared-for Dalmatian can live between 10–13 years. But don’t let that number scare you—some have even reached their late teens! 🎉
Fun fact: Those spots start as tiny freckles at birth and fully bloom by about 9 months old. It’s like watching nature paint its masterpiece right before your eyes! 🎨🐾
2. Health Hurdles: Why Are Dalmatians So Special? 🔬
Here’s where things get interesting (and slightly tricky). Dalmatians are prone to urinary stones due to a genetic condition called hyperuricemia. Translation: They produce more uric acid than most dogs. Don’t worry—it’s manageable with proper diet and hydration. 💧
Another quirk? Deafness. Studies show around 8%–10% of Dalmatians are born deaf in one or both ears. Early testing is key here, folks. If your pup has selective hearing during "treat time," chances are they’re just being sassy. 😂
3. Maximizing Their Years: Tips for a Longer Tail-Wagging Life 🌟
Nutrition: Feed them high-quality kibble designed for active breeds. Think lean proteins, veggies, and no junk food. Remember, pizza crumbs won’t make anyone’s coat shine brighter. 🍕❌
Exercise: These pups were bred to run alongside carriages back in the day. That means daily walks, playtime, and maybe even agility training. Burn that energy, Dal-mates! 🏃♂️💨
Vet Visits: Regular check-ups are crucial. Your vet will be your best friend when it comes to catching issues early. Plus, who doesn’t love puppy breath kisses during post-exam cuddles? 🦴
